5 Warning Signs Your Water Softener Is Undersized
How can you tell if your water softener is struggling to keep up? Look for persistent hard water symptoms like soap scum and mineral spots on fixtures and dishes. These telltale signs indicate your system isn't effectively treating your water, despite being installed.
When your softener struggles, the signs appear on every surface—soap scum and mineral spots are your water's silent distress signals.
We often see undersized softeners regenerating far too frequently—sometimes daily or even more often. This excessive cycling means your system is overworked and lacks sufficient grain capacity for your household's demands.
You might also notice soft water shortages during peak usage times. When multiple showers, laundry, and dishwashers run simultaneously, hard water may breakthrough unexpectedly.
Finally, watch your operational costs. If you're constantly refilling salt and seeing higher water bills, your softener is likely working overtime—a clear indicator it's too small for your needs.

Calculating the Right Size Water Softener for Your Household
Properly sizing your water softener remains the single most critical factor in protecting your home from hard water damage.
We've seen countless homeowners make the expensive mistake of installing undersized systems that can't keep up with demand.
To calculate your ideal softener size, multiply household members by 75 gallons (average daily usage per person), then multiply by your water hardness level in GPG. This gives you your daily grain requirement.p>Calculating your daily grain requirement is simple:
People × 75 gallons × Water hardness (GPG) = The exact softener capacity you need.
For example, a family of four with 10 GPG hardness needs a system that handles about 3,000 grains daily (4 × 75 × 10).
We recommend a 24,000-grain unit for this scenario, providing adequate capacity while minimizing regeneration cycles.
Don't guess—measure twice, purchase once.

Is It Better to Oversize or Undersize a Water Softener?
We'd recommend slight oversizing rather than undersizing your water softener. While both have drawbacks, an undersized system can't meet your needs, causing immediate scale problems throughout your home's plumbing system.
Why Are States Banning Water Softeners?
We're seeing states ban water softeners because they discharge high sodium levels, contaminating water systems. They damage aquatic ecosystems, burden municipal treatment facilities, and worsen existing groundwater salinity issues in vulnerable regions.
